how much should i sell my website for?

Discussion in 'General Marketing' started by blankfile, Nov 21, 2013.

  1. #1
    i have this website aged 2 years. it's about learning how to sing. very niche, difficult to even get solo ads for it. most of my traffic is from google.

    the site gets 500-600 uniques/month. around 40 unique articles that i wrote myself

    here are the income stats:

    3158 impressions
    79 clicks
    4 leads
    $719.70 sales

    this is for november

    i have just started collecting emails for listbuilding with only 3 subs so far

    i want to sell it off on flippa to get cash and move on to a more profitable niche

    anyone with experience flipping sites on flippa? any help would be much appreciated. thanks

    I would say 6X Monthly gross income or so. That seems to be the going rate right now. Depending on the niche or source of income you may get a little more or less.

    I've sold a lot of sites since I started back in 2006. I rarely sell a site LESS than 10-12x monthly revenue.
    If your site is making around $500 - $700 a month you could fetch up to $7,000 for it.
